DESCRIPTION


• A classic mummy loaded with 60 oz of DuPont Quallofil® inside a red nylon cover and silver liner • For extreme conditions down to -10°

This is a pretty good mummy bag. It is very comfortable. My only gripe is that my feet kept getting cold in this bag. It is a good bag, but there might be something better out there. I only paid $50 for it at Coleman and I have gotten my money's worth out of it. Whenever I take it backpacking, I bring those hand warmer thingys and put them in my socks before I go to bed to keep my feet warm.
